Knobs: Level, Attack, Sustain. Basic 3-knob compression. Easy to get a good sound out of it.

My setup: MIM Lefty Strat -> CP-1 Compressor -> TS7 Tubescreamer -> Fender Blues Junior.
Sounds very good in front of a good overdrive. Adds more beef to single coil sounds by increasing sustain while adding punch and clarity to chords. Pretty low noise even when played through a cranked amp. The fat sustain and punch give me a good Trey Anastasio tone with my setup.

One of the only disadvantages of this pedal (if you look at it that way) is that it has plastic casing. However, the casing is very thick and it would definitely hold up well as long as the pedal is not horribly abused (and I mean it would almost have to be intentional). Other than that the switch seems to be of good quality and I would probably gig without a backup.

I play stuff along the lines of Oasis, Phish, RHCP, Radiohead, Pearl Jam, etc. Goes very well with a good overdrive pedal and tube amp for playing my types of music. I've been playing for four years and have owned a Boss CS-3, MXR Dynacomp, and a DOD Milkbox. I bought this for something a little different, I ended up with something that I actually think is a little better. If it had metal casing, it would be nearly perfect for me.
